The Jumper being used is from 1980.Trevor Hughes last year as coach.

here is abit of a report on 1980

" The Season of Injuries "
The 1980 season could well go down as the
year of injuries. We played 52 players throughout
the whole season, approximately twice as many
as the premiership side Port Adelaide.
But even with this tremendous set back when
on a Thursday night if the selectors could get away
without changing one particular line in the
complete side they thought themselves very lucky.
We still had our moments of glory, six wins, one
against Sturt where we kicked 10 goals in the
First term shows we have the making of a top five
side given our share of injuries and not the in-
credibly bad run 1980 unloaded on us.
Trevor Hughes took it in his stride, never com-
plained and set an extremely good example to
player and committeemen alike and must be given
high praise for the way he tried to put a side
together and if hours counted for any premier-
ship points then Trevor would have gone top. I
am sure Trevor will be around W.A. forever, and
any undertaking he takes on the players, commit-
tee and supporters wish him well and loads of
success.
And now 1981 ā€” Neil Kerley comes home.
Peter Meuret stays home. Geoff Morris renews
his contract. Roger Luders signs for three years.
This has happened and more will. West Adelaide
are looking for your support in '81 because we will
be proud and successful and this does not happen,
it is made to happen with your help.
KERLS BACK ā€” WHY ARN'T YOU

DOUG THOMAS, General Manager
